The Role of Pengadilan Tata Usaha Negara in Resolving Administrative Disputes

Administrative disputes are a common occurrence in any society governed by administrative law. These disputes often arise from conflicts between individuals or entities and government agencies. In Indonesia, the resolution of such disputes falls under the jurisdiction of the Pengadilan Tata Usaha Negara (PTUN), which plays a crucial role in ensuring the fair and just resolution of administrative conflicts. This article delves into the juridical analysis of the role of PTUN in resolving administrative disputes, highlighting its significance and impact on the legal landscape.

Understanding Administrative Disputes

Before delving into the role of PTUN, it is essential to comprehend the nature of administrative disputes. These disputes typically revolve around decisions or actions taken by government bodies that affect the rights or interests of individuals or organizations. They can encompass a wide range of issues, including land disputes, licensing matters, employment-related conflicts, and regulatory compliance issues. The resolution of administrative disputes requires a specialized understanding of administrative law and procedures, which is where the PTUN comes into play.

Juridical Framework of PTUN

The establishment of PTUN is rooted in the legal framework of Indonesia, particularly Law No. 5 of 1986 concerning Administrative Court. This law provides the legal basis for the existence and functioning of PTUN as a specialized judicial institution tasked with adjudicating administrative disputes. The PTUN operates independently and is vested with the authority to review and rule on administrative decisions, ensuring that they adhere to the principles of legality, fairness, and justice. This juridical framework empowers PTUN to serve as a crucial mechanism for upholding the rule of law in administrative matters.

Judicial Review and Legal Remedies

One of the primary functions of PTUN is to conduct judicial review of administrative decisions and actions. Through this process, PTUN assesses the legality and validity of administrative measures, ensuring that they are in accordance with the prevailing laws and regulations. In cases where individuals or entities have been aggrieved by administrative actions, PTUN provides avenues for seeking legal remedies, including the annulment or revision of administrative decisions. This judicial review mechanism serves as a safeguard against arbitrary or unlawful exercises of administrative power, thereby promoting accountability and transparency in governance.
